#b97104 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b97104 is composed of 72.5% red, 44.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 97.8%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 36.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 37.1%. #b97104 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e208 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#b97104 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b97104 has RGB values of R:185, G:113,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.98,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12153092.

Shades and Tints of #b97104
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f8 is the lightest one.
